Upcoming Events
Jun
19
Friday, June 19, 2026 at 6:00 AM
Jun
21
Sunday, June 21, 2026 at 10:00 AM
Jun
21
Sunday, June 21, 2026 at 1:00 PM
Jun
22
Monday, June 22, 2026 at 6:00 AM
Jun
22
Monday, June 22, 2026 at 6:00 PM
Jun
23
Tuesday, June 23, 2026 at 6:00 AM
Jun
23
Tuesday, June 23, 2026 at 6:00 PM
Jun
24
Wednesday, June 24, 2026 at 6:00 AM
Jun
25
Thursday, June 25, 2026 at 6:00 AM
Jun
26
Friday, June 26, 2026 at 6:00 AM
